[Waterloo-Cedar Falls Courier, Wednesday, June 30, 2004]

WATERLOO — Helen E. McCulley, 82, of Waterloo, died Monday June 28, 2004, at Allen Hospital of natural causes.

She was born Nov. 6, 1921, in Delhi, daughter of Edmund H. and Augusta B. Bondurant Fleming.

She married Herbert N. McCulley Sept. 14,1945, in Iowa City He died on Sept. 26,1977. She then married Richard A. Meyerhoff June 28, 1985, in Oskaloosa.

Mrs. McCulley was employed as a teacher for several school systems in Iowa.

Survivors include her husband, Richard Meyerhoff of Waterloo; two sons, Michael J. (Debbie) McCulley of Harlingen, Texas, and Kevin K. (Andrea) McCulley of Waterloo; two stepdaughters, Nancy Meyerhoff of Maple Grove, Minn., and Katie (Al) Schares of Cedar Falls; one brother, Francis (Lois) Fleming of Waterloo; and four grandchildren.

Services: 10:30 a.m. Thursday at First United Methodist Church, with burial in the Waterloo Memorial Park Cemetery Friends may call from 4 to 7 p.m. today at Kearns-Huisman-Schumacher Chapel on Kimball and also for an hour before the service at the church.

Memorials may be directed to First United Methodist Church or the Salvation Army.
